Understanding Your Volvo V50 Cooling System
The cooling system of your Volvo V50 is crucial for maintaining your vehicle's performance and longevity. At the heart of this system is the car radiator, a vital component that ensures your engine does not overheat. The radiator's primary function is to dissipate heat away from the engine coolant, allowing your Volvo V50 to operate at the optimal temperature.
Why the Car Radiator is Key to Your Volvo V50
For your Volvo V50, a properly functioning car radiator is essential. It prevents engine overheating, which can lead to significant damage and costly repairs. The radiator is also integral to the cooling heating balance within your vehicle, contributing to the overall climate control and comfort for passengers.
Signs You May Need a New Volvo V50 Radiator
Several indicators may suggest that your Volvo V50 car radiator needs attention or replacement. These include overheating, visible leaks or corrosion, and fluctuations in engine temperature. If you notice any of these signs, it is important to address the issue promptly to avoid further damage to your vehicle's engine.

What is a Car Radiator?
When running, engines generate extreme amounts of heat, which, if uncontrolled, will cause extensive damage. If the engine block overheats, the engine oil will break down, and the moving components will generate too much friction, causing damage through wear and tear.
This is combated by engine coolant, which travels through the engine, absorbing heat before it is dissipated via the radiator. The radiator, then, is integral to the car’s cooling system and the well-being of the engine.
When the radiator leaks or suffers damage, your car can suffer catastrophic overheating, making it critical to replace a damaged radiator.
